I keep it real simple after seeing guys bring 100 foot-long 16-gauge AC extension cords to gigs expecting to hook a bunch of backline and PA stuff up using a power strip. I always have a couple of 25-foot 12 gauges and an 80-foot 12 gauge in my gig stuff.

A MODERN BAND should have a power distribution system. This does not need to be complex.
You can build a power BOX with a rolling ATA type case that for the USA consists of: A 4 wire 6 ga cord of adequate length to get to a Venue's power supply.
That will give you 50 amps at 240-250 Volts and it should feed a standard house type circuit breaker panel with at least 8 - 20 amp breakers. Mount this panel inside the ATA box.
Come off the panel with 8 -12ga rubber three wire cords and mount metal quad boxes with a pair of duplex outlets in each box. Make sure the box is grounded along with the outlets.
Each box should go to a station in the band for each musician's power. When building the device make sure to spread the load evenly on each side of the 240 v line. Bass on one side, PA on the other. Or if the PA is 240V powered, bass on one side and the two guitars on the other phase.
Spread lighting around evenly.
If you are a huge band you may need to build a three phase system or 480V system... If you need this stuff YOU ARE MY FRIEND and don't even know it.
A good power system could be built for about $500 -1000 bucks or so. You could even include quality commercial surge suppression at the panels, GFI breakers, all the stuff to make it safe for all environments.
